The Mathematical Reality of Fixed Income for Minors
Most standard financial planning conversations assume an adult worker needs fixed income to smooth out the volatility of their portfolio as they approach their withdrawal phase. A fifty-five-year-old manager buys corporate bonds specifically so they do not have to sell equities at a massive loss during an economic recession. A newborn baby or a five-year-old child operates on an entirely different physical timeline. They possess the greatest asset available in financial mathematics, which is an unbroken two-decade runway before they need to liquidate anything for basic living expenses. Placing a minor's long-term capital into fixed-income instruments like government bonds mathematically stunts the geometric growth potential of their portfolio. Every single dollar allocated to government debt instead of a broad market equity fund acts as an active drag on their long-term net worth.
Government debt serves exactly one function. It protects nominal principal while generating a modest, predictable yield. If you deposit ten thousand dollars into a United States Treasury note, you will receive your exact ten thousand dollars back upon maturity, plus the agreed-upon coupon payments. The government does not default on its direct obligations. However, this absolute safety of principal comes at a severe cost. The yield provided by government bonds historically barely outpaces the actual rate of consumer inflation. The purchasing power remains relatively flat. You protected the number on the computer screen, but you did not actually increase the physical volume of goods or services that money can buy in the real economy. For a toddler who does not need the capital until they turn thirty, flat purchasing power represents a terrible mathematical outcome.
To understand the limitation of bonds, you must look at the mathematical alternative. Broad market index funds tracking the total domestic stock market historically return an annualized average of roughly seven to ten percent before inflation. A ten-thousand-dollar investment in an equity fund made on a child's first birthday undergoes multiple doubling cycles before they graduate from high school. Equities represent actual ownership in profit-generating corporations that can raise their prices to combat inflation. Bonds simply represent a fixed loan. When inflation spikes to eight percent, the corporations in an equity index charge more for their products, increasing their revenue and eventually driving the stock price higher. A fixed-rate bond issued at three percent yield simply bleeds purchasing power in that exact same inflationary environment. Locking a child's inheritance into debt instruments for two decades ignores the reality of how corporate profits compound over time. The stock market heavily penalizes those who seek extreme safety over long time horizons. You must accept short-term price volatility to capture long-term wealth creation.
If equities dominate over the long term, why should a family ever purchase United States bonds for a child? The answer lies entirely in sequence of returns risk and short-term capital requirements. Not all money saved for a child is intended for their retirement decades into the future. Families save money for highly specific, impending liabilities. They need cash to pay for private high school tuition in exactly three years. They need to hand a teenager a lump sum for a vehicle purchase in eighteen months. They manage a 529 college savings plan that they intend to liquidate starting exactly in the fall semester of the child's freshman year. When the timeline shrinks from twenty years to twenty months, equities become incredibly dangerous. If you leave a teenager's tuition money in a stock market index fund and the market drops twenty percent just before the tuition bill arrives, you permanently destroyed one-fifth of that capital. You cannot wait out the recovery because the university bursar demands payment immediately. This exact scenario is where government debt excels. Short-term Treasury bonds isolate the capital from market crashes. They guarantee the exact dollar amount will be available on the exact date required. Government debt acts as a secure staging ground for capital that has a defined, impending exit date.
Duration Risk and the Opportunity Cost of Capital
Bonds carry a specific mathematical vulnerability known as duration risk. If you buy a ten-year Treasury note yielding four percent, and general interest rates suddenly rise to six percent the following year, the market value of your existing bond drops. Nobody wants to buy your four percent bond on the secondary market when they can easily buy a new six percent bond straight from the government. For institutional bond traders, this price fluctuation causes severe panic. For a parent holding a bond to maturity for a child, this market fluctuation means absolutely nothing. If you hold the federal debt until the specific maturity date printed on the calendar, the government pays you exactly what they contracted to pay. You only realize a loss if you panic and sell the asset early.
Understanding the yield curve helps parents decide which specific bonds to buy. A normal yield curve pays investors a higher interest rate for locking up their money for a longer period. An inverted yield curve occurs when short-term debt, like a six-month Treasury bill, pays a higher interest rate than a ten-year Treasury note. At this exact moment, families must constantly evaluate the curve to avoid taking on unnecessary duration risk. If a one-year bill pays more than a five-year note, tying up a child's capital for five years makes mathematical sense only if you strongly believe rates will crash in the near future. You must align the length of the bond with the child's actual expected need for the cash flow.
The Specific Utility of Government Debt in a Child's Portfolio
Asset-liability matching requires strict precision. You calculate exactly when the child will need the capital and buy a bond that matures weeks before that specific date. A family does not randomly buy thirty-year Treasury bonds for a high school freshman expecting to use the funds for undergraduate tuition. They buy specific Treasury bills or notes that mature in exactly two, three, or four years.
Consider a father looking at his daughter's impending college timeline. She starts her freshman year in exactly thirty-six months. He has twenty thousand dollars sitting in a checking account designated for her first year of room and board. He cannot risk this money in the stock market. Instead of leaving it in the bank, he logs into a commercial brokerage account and buys a United States Treasury note that matures in exactly thirty-five months. The money earns a fixed, guaranteed state-tax-free yield for exactly three years. When the bond matures, the federal government deposits the principal and the final interest payment directly into his settlement fund. The cash becomes fully liquid exactly thirty days before the university bill arrives. This completely eliminates market risk, removes duration risk, and heavily outpaces the yield of a standard commercial checking account.
Real-World Trade-Off: Capital Preservation Versus Geometric Growth
Consider a dual-income household in Grand Rapids holding fifteen thousand dollars for their daughter. The child currently sits two years old. The parents face a specific choice regarding capital allocation. If they purchase a ten-year United States Treasury note yielding slightly over four percent, they commit a massive mathematical error. Over a decade, that bond produces roughly six thousand dollars in total interest. The principal remains perfectly safe, but the purchasing power barely outpaces standard inflation. They protected the nominal number on the screen, but they sacrificed the actual economic weight of the money. Placing that same fifteen thousand dollars into a broad market index fund introduces short-term price volatility. However, historical averages suggest the principal could easily double over that same decade. They surrendered geometric growth for absolute safety they did not mathematically require.
Now change the variables completely. The daughter is sixteen years old. The parents plan to use that exact fifteen thousand dollars to pay for her first year of university housing and tuition. The timeline compresses from ten years down to twenty-four months. Placing that money into a stock market index fund right now introduces catastrophic risk. A standard economic recession could easily reduce that fifteen thousand dollars to eleven thousand dollars just as the university issues the invoice. The parents cannot wait out a market recovery because the bursar demands immediate payment. The correct move requires buying specific Treasury bills that mature exactly when the bills come due. The family actively sacrifices the potential for double-digit equity gains to secure an absolute guarantee of principal preservation. The timeline dictates the asset class without any room for emotional preference.
| Asset Class | Primary Risk Factor | Expected Return Profile | Ideal Time Horizon |
|---|---|---|---|
| Broad Market Equities | Short-term price volatility | High growth, outpaces inflation | Ten or more years |
| Series I Savings Bonds | Opportunity cost of capital | Matches inflation exactly plus fixed rate | One to five years |
| Short-Term Treasury Bills | Reinvestment rate risk | Low, defined nominal yield | Under two years |
Dissecting Series I Savings Bonds for Minors
When retail investors discuss family finance involving government debt, they almost always mean Series I savings bonds. These specific instruments gained massive popularity when consumer inflation spiked heavily, pushing their annualized yields near ten percent for a brief window. Unlike traditional fixed-rate bonds that pay the exact same coupon amount every six months regardless of economic conditions, I bonds exist specifically to defend purchasing power against a depreciating currency. The United States Treasury designed them strictly as a retail product. You cannot buy them in standard commercial brokerage accounts. You cannot trade them on secondary markets. You must buy them directly from the government through the TreasuryDirect portal, up to a strict legal limit of ten thousand dollars per social security number per calendar year.
The federal government does not offer this inflation protection for free. They demand strict liquidity concessions in return. Every single Series I bond carries a mandatory twelve-month lockup period. Once you click purchase on the TreasuryDirect website, that capital is completely inaccessible for exactly one calendar year. You cannot cash it out to pay for an emergency medical bill. You cannot withdraw it to fix a broken vehicle transmission. The money simply sits locked in the federal ledger. Parents absolutely must understand this restriction before dumping a child's entire savings account into an I bond.
After the first twelve months expire, the bond becomes liquid, but it enters a penalty phase. If you cash out a Series I bond before holding it for five full years, the Treasury automatically deducts the last three months of accrued interest from your final payout as an early withdrawal penalty. This creates a highly specific math problem for families. If a bond currently yields a very high rate, losing the last three months of interest hurts significantly. If the inflation rate has recently dropped and the bond barely yields anything, the three-month penalty is mathematically trivial. After five years, the penalty disappears entirely, and the bond remains perfectly liquid until it stops earning interest at the thirty-year mark.
Inflation Tracking and the Composite Rate Structure
The yield on a Series I bond combines two entirely separate mathematical figures into a single composite rate. The first figure is the fixed rate. When you buy the bond, the Treasury assigns a fixed rate that never changes for the entire thirty-year life of the bond. If you secure a bond with a fixed rate of one point three percent, that specific bond will always generate that base yield. The second figure is the inflation rate. The Treasury calculates this rate twice a year, specifically on the first day of May and November, based directly on changes in the non-seasonally adjusted Consumer Price Index for all Urban Consumers.
The system combines the permanent fixed rate with the semi-annual inflation rate to create the current composite yield. This means the interest your child's bond generates will fluctuate wildly depending on the broader economy. If inflation runs hot, the bond pays a massive yield. If the economy enters a deflationary period, the inflation portion drops to zero, though the composite rate can never legally fall below zero. This unique structure ensures that the physical cash stored in the bond theoretically buys the exact same amount of groceries or tuition credits a decade from now as it does today. It acts as a perfect mathematical hedge against currency debasement, making it an excellent holding tank for a minor's medium-term cash.
The One-Year Lockup and Five-Year Penalty Window
Beyond the electronic ten-thousand-dollar limit, the tax code provides a small loophole for acquiring more I bonds. When a taxpayer files their annual federal tax return, they can use IRS Form 8888 to direct up to five thousand dollars of their specific tax refund toward the purchase of paper Series I savings bonds. The government physically mails these paper bonds to your house. Aside from this very narrow tax refund loophole, all savings bonds now exist purely as digital book-entry securities. This allows a family to theoretically acquire fifteen thousand dollars of I bonds per calendar year, utilizing the electronic maximum and the paper refund maximum. Parents must track these physical paper documents meticulously. If you lose the paper bonds, the replacement process requires filing specific lost security forms with the Treasury, taking several months to resolve.
The penalty structure requires strict attention to the calendar. If you plan to use the I bond cash in exactly three years, you must mentally subtract three months of yield from your total expected return calculation. The Treasury enforces this penalty rigidly. You cannot call a customer service representative and ask for a waiver. The system calculates the deduction automatically at the exact moment you click the redemption button on the digital dashboard. You must accept this friction as the cost of securing perfect inflation matching.
Real-World Trade-Off: Parking Bar Mitzvah Cash Versus High-Yield Savings
A woman operating a three-stall dog grooming business in Omaha needs to park ten thousand dollars her son received from relatives for his Bar Mitzvah. The thirteen-year-old boy wants to buy a reliable used car when he turns sixteen. The mother evaluates a commercial high-yield savings account paying four percent against a newly issued Series I savings bond yielding a similar composite rate. The commercial account provides immediate liquidity. The teenager can log in and see the balance every day. However, the interest earned faces both federal income tax and Nebraska state income tax annually, dragging down the real return. The bank can also drop that yield to zero tomorrow if the central bank cuts rates.
The Series I bond locks the money up entirely for the first year. Because the boy cannot legally drive for three years, this restriction means nothing. The interest on the government bond completely avoids state income tax. Furthermore, they defer paying any federal tax on the growth until the exact year they cash it out. When they sell the bond in year three to buy the vehicle, they incur a penalty equal to three months of interest. The state tax exemption and the guaranteed inflation matching heavily outweigh the minor interest penalty. The government bond mathematically wins.
| Feature | Series I Savings Bond | High-Yield Savings Account |
|---|---|---|
| Interest Rate Structure | Fixed base plus variable inflation rate | Variable bank rate changing daily |
| Liquidity Access | Locked entirely for first twelve months | Fully liquid immediately |
| Early Withdrawal Penalty | Lose three months interest if cashed under five years | None |
| State Income Tax Status | Completely exempt from state taxes | Fully taxable at state level |
The Mathematical Trap of Series EE Bonds
Older generations harbor a deep sentimental attachment to Series EE savings bonds. For decades, grandparents purchased physical paper EE bonds at local bank branches for half their face value and placed them inside birthday cards. You paid twenty-five dollars for a bond with fifty dollars printed on the front, expecting it to mature eventually. The Treasury completely terminated this program years ago, shifting the entire process to the digital TreasuryDirect system. Today, you buy electronic EE bonds at exact face value. If you want a thousand-dollar bond, you pay exactly one thousand dollars. While the delivery method modernized, the underlying mathematics of the Series EE bond make it a terrible investment choice for practically every child in the United States.
The current fixed interest rate offered on newly issued Series EE bonds sits at a microscopic fraction of a percent. By itself, the stated interest rate cannot beat basic inflation, let alone build actual wealth. The only reason anyone buys an EE bond is the Treasury's twenty-year doubling guarantee. The federal government legally promises that if you hold an EE bond for exactly twenty years, they will make a one-time adjustment to the account value to ensure the bond is worth exactly double its original purchase price. If you buy a ten-thousand-dollar EE bond for a newborn, the government guarantees it will be worth twenty thousand dollars on their twentieth birthday, regardless of how low the actual interest rate remained during those two decades.
People see the word double and immediately assume it represents a massive return on investment. Financial mathematics reveal a much darker reality. According to the Rule of 72, an asset that takes exactly twenty years to double generates an annualized return of roughly three and a half percent. Locking capital up for two solid decades just to capture a meager nominal return represents a massive strategic failure. If consumer inflation averages three percent over those same twenty years, the actual real return of the EE bond hovers near zero. You surrendered control of your cash for a generation and gained almost zero purchasing power in return.
The Twenty-Year Doubling Guarantee
The twenty-year rule demands absolute, unwavering patience. The guarantee only exists if you hold the asset for the full two decades. If a family buys an EE bond and panics, cashing it out in year nineteen to pay for a college expense, they forfeit the doubling guarantee completely. The Treasury will only pay them the face value plus the abysmal stated fixed interest rate earned over those nineteen years. Cashing an EE bond early destroys the entire mathematical premise of buying it in the first place.
This massive opportunity cost restricts the utility of EE bonds to highly specific scenarios. You only buy an EE bond for a child if you possess absolute certainty that the child will not need the capital before their twentieth birthday. They function beautifully as a college graduation gift or a forced savings mechanism for a young adult's first real estate down payment. They fail miserably as a general emergency fund or a flexible college savings tool. Parents must segregate their capital mentally. The cash allocated to EE bonds must act as dead money to the household for two full decades. You simply cannot touch it.
Purchasing Power Degradation Over Two Decades
The opportunity cost of the EE bond actively destroys wealth. The exact same ten thousand dollars placed into a low-cost Standard and Poor's 500 index fund with an assumed annualized return of eight percent grows to over forty-six thousand dollars over a twenty-year timeline. The parent who chooses the EE bond intentionally leaves twenty-six thousand dollars of potential wealth on the table to secure a guarantee they never actually needed. Furthermore, the EE bond forces an incredibly rigid exit strategy. If you cash out the EE bond at year nineteen because the child needs the money for college tuition slightly earlier than anticipated, you miss the doubling adjustment entirely. You walk away with just the principal plus the microscopic fixed interest rate, realizing practically zero growth over nineteen years. The EE bond operates as an archaic relic of a high-interest-rate past, entirely unsuited for modern wealth building.
| Investment Vehicle | Initial Deposit | Assumed Annual Rate | Value After Twenty Years |
|---|---|---|---|
| Series EE Savings Bond | $10,000 | Calculated 3.5% based on guarantee | $20,000 exactly |
| Broad Market Equity Index | $10,000 | 8.0% historical average | $46,609 approximately |
| Lost Opportunity Cost | None | None | $26,609 surrendered |
Marketable Treasury Bills and Notes for Shorter Horizons
Beyond retail savings bonds, families have direct access to the exact same marketable debt instruments purchased by massive hedge funds and foreign central banks. Treasury bills represent short-term obligations backed directly by the full faith and credit of the United States government. The Treasury issues them in highly specific increments ranging from four weeks to fifty-two weeks. They do not pay standard interest coupons. Instead, you purchase a Treasury bill at a discount to its face value. You buy a thousand-dollar bill for nine hundred and fifty dollars today. When the bill matures in exactly fifty-two weeks, the government deposits one thousand dollars directly into your linked checking account. The fifty-dollar difference represents your interest earned. Treasury notes operate on longer timelines, stretching from two years up to ten years, and pay physical interest coupons every six months until maturity.
You do not need to use the clunky TreasuryDirect website to purchase these specific assets. Marketable Treasury bills and notes trade openly on the secondary market. You can log into a standard Uniform Transfers to Minors Act custodial account at a commercial broker like Charles Schwab or Fidelity and buy them directly. This provides instant liquidity. If you buy a two-year Treasury note and suddenly need the cash six months later, you just sell it on the open market. The price you get depends entirely on current interest rates, but the liquidity remains absolute. You manage the child's equities and the child's government debt in the exact same software ecosystem.
For family finance, short-term Treasury bills offer exceptional utility. They allow parents to capture current high interest rates without locking up capital for years. If a teenager works a summer job and earns four thousand dollars, placing that cash into a thirteen-week Treasury bill generates state-tax-free yield while keeping the money perfectly accessible for the upcoming school year. The constant rollover of short-term bills ensures the cash stays active.
Building a Treasury Ladder for Impending College Tuition
Marketable Treasury securities allow families to construct highly precise cash flow ladders to handle massive, predictable expenses like higher education. You do not want a hundred thousand dollars sitting in a single savings account entirely exposed to falling bank interest rates over a four-year college career. Instead, families construct a Treasury ladder. If a child begins college today, the parents take the money earmarked for the sophomore year and buy a fifty-two-week Treasury bill. They take the money for the junior year and buy a two-year Treasury note. They take the senior year money and buy a three-year Treasury note.
This strategy locks in exact yield guarantees for the entire duration of the degree. The family completely ignores what the Federal Reserve does with interest rates because their yields are mathematically fixed by the purchased bonds. As each semester approaches, a bond matures, dropping exact liquid cash into the checking account right as the tuition invoice arrives. You eliminate reinvestment rate risk and ensure that the exact dollar amount needed exists precisely when the university demands it. You execute this plan flawlessly without ever exposing the tuition funds to a stock market correction.
The Administrative Burden of TreasuryDirect
Executing any of the savings bond strategies requires interfacing directly with the United States government's proprietary retail website, TreasuryDirect. Financial planners routinely warn clients that the administrative friction associated with this specific website acts as a massive deterrent. The interface looks and functions exactly like a government database built in the late nineteen nineties. It relies on archaic security protocols, an incredibly unforgiving password reset process, and a virtual keyboard for login entry that infuriates modern users accustomed to facial recognition software. You must approach the TreasuryDirect system with immense patience. Entering incorrect banking information or failing a security question will result in a hard lock on the account, requiring a physical phone call to a government call center that routinely experiences hold times exceeding two hours.
You cannot use the browser's back button. If you click the back arrow to fix a typo, the system automatically kicks you out of your session entirely, forcing you to log in again using the virtual keyboard. The website enforces an aggressive timeout protocol, terminating your session if you pause to look for an account number. Parents managing multiple linked accounts for several children frequently find the interface intensely frustrating. You must treat your login credentials with extreme care, keeping the exact bank account linked for the duration of the strategy. Document the exact security question answers meticulously.
The inability to access funds quickly during a lockout ruins the entire utility of short-term fixed income. You do not want the tuition deadline to arrive while you wait for a clerk in Minnesota to process a signature guarantee. The administrative burden is the exact price you pay for securing inflation-protected savings bonds that the commercial market simply refuses to offer. You accept the bad software to capture the good math.
Setting Up a Linked Minor Account
The government does not allow minor children to open independent TreasuryDirect accounts. A ten-year-old cannot have a primary login. Instead, a parent or legal guardian must establish their own primary adult account first. Once the adult clears the identity verification process and links their own commercial bank account, they click deep into the menu system to create a linked account for the minor child. The adult operates as the absolute custodian of this linked account. All bond purchases for the child must execute through the parent's primary portal.
The child's social security number attaches to the linked account for tax reporting purposes, but the child possesses zero operational control. When the child finally turns eighteen and reaches the legal age of majority, the process does not happen automatically. The young adult must create their own brand-new primary TreasuryDirect account. The parent must then manually initiate a transfer of every individual bond from the linked minor account over to the new adult account. This de-linking process often trips fraud alerts if the addresses or banking details do not match perfectly, causing severe delays in liquidity access.
The Signature Guarantee Obstacle for Redemptions
The administrative burden magnifies exponentially if an account locks due to suspected fraud or if a family attempts to fix a banking error. The Treasury Department relies heavily on a verification process involving IRS Form 5444. You cannot simply use a standard notary public working at a local shipping store to verify your identity. You must find an authorized officer at a financial institution where you hold an existing account to physically stamp the Treasury form with a Medallion Signature Guarantee or a specific bank seal guaranteeing your identity and your right to manage the account.
Finding a bank manager willing to provide this stamp creates massive logistical headaches. Many commercial banks refuse to stamp Treasury documents due to liability concerns, even for customers holding significant deposits. A parent attempting to unlock an account to pay for a teenager's first semester of trade school might spend weeks driving to different bank branches in Tampa, Florida, simply begging a manager to execute the required form. You then mail the physical paper to a processing center in Minneapolis and wait weeks for a manual unlock. Families must absolutely ensure their banking details remain perfectly accurate to avoid triggering these holds.
Tax Implications of US Savings Bonds for Education
The federal tax code treats United States government debt with specific deference. Any interest generated by a Treasury bill, note, or savings bond is completely exempt from all state and local income taxes. If you live in a high-tax state like California or New York, avoiding state taxes on investment yield provides a significant mathematical advantage over corporate bonds or commercial certificates of deposit. You still owe federal income tax on the generated interest. For Series I and Series EE bonds, you can choose to defer paying that federal income tax entirely until you actually cash out the bond, allowing the interest to compound cleanly without an annual tax drag.
The taxation of a minor's unearned income falls under the strict rules of the federal Kiddie Tax. The Internal Revenue Service created these rules specifically to stop wealthy parents from hiding capital gains in their children's lower tax brackets. Currently, a child can earn roughly one thousand three hundred dollars of unearned investment income entirely tax-free. The next identical tier faces taxation at the child's marginal rate, which usually sits at ten percent. Any unearned income generated above that specific threshold gets heavily taxed at the parents' marginal tax rate. A large portfolio of corporate bonds held in a child's name easily triggers this punitive tax structure every single year. Savings bonds solve this by deferring the income event until the exact year of redemption.
The federal government explicitly incentivizes using savings bonds to fund higher education through a specific tax exclusion detailed on IRS Form 8815. If a taxpayer cashes out an eligible Series EE or Series I savings bond and uses the proceeds to pay for qualified higher education expenses at an eligible institution, they can exclude the entire interest portion from their federal taxable income. Qualified expenses strictly include tuition and mandatory fees. They absolutely do not include room and board, meal plans, or off-campus housing rent. If you execute this correctly, the money grows free of state tax, defers federal tax, and entirely escapes federal tax upon exit.
The Education Tax Exclusion Income Phase-Outs
This exclusion comes with incredibly strict ownership rules that routinely trap unsuspecting parents. To qualify for the tax-free education exclusion, the parent must be the registered owner of the bond. The child can be listed as a beneficiary on the bond, but the child absolutely cannot be the registered owner. The owner must have been at least twenty-four years old on the exact day the bond was issued. If a well-meaning grandparent buys an I bond and registers it directly in the toddler's name, that specific bond permanently loses eligibility for the Form 8815 exclusion. When the child cashes it out for tuition at age eighteen, they will owe federal income tax on the interest.
The Form 8815 exclusion also operates under a severe income phase-out structure. The tax break exists to facilitate college funding for middle-class families, not to shelter the wealth of high-net-worth individuals. The Internal Revenue Service adjusts these income limits annually for inflation. If a married couple filing jointly reports a Modified Adjusted Gross Income exceeding the upper phase-out limit in the exact year they cash the bond out, the tax exclusion completely vanishes. They owe full federal taxes on all the accumulated interest, regardless of whether they used the cash for tuition. Middle-class families frequently rely on this exclusion for eighteen years, only to realize a sudden late-career promotion pushed them over the income limit right as the child enters college, triggering a massive unexpected tax bill.
Real-World Trade-Off: Cashing Bonds for Private High School Versus College
A database architect in Austin holds twenty thousand dollars in Series I bonds registered in his own name. The bonds currently carry roughly four thousand dollars in deferred, untaxed interest. He wants to send his fourteen-year-old daughter to an expensive private high school. He needs cash to pay the upcoming tuition invoice. He also knows he will need money for a state university in four years. He must decide whether to cash the bonds now to pay the high school or hold them for college.
The federal tax code specifically dictates that only higher education expenses qualify for the Form 8815 exclusion. Post-secondary universities and specific vocational schools count. Private high school tuition absolutely does not count. If he cashes the bonds today for the high school invoice, he must immediately pay federal income taxes on the entire four thousand dollars of accumulated interest. If he leaves the bonds alone, cash-flows the high school tuition from his ordinary salary, and redeems the bonds four years later to pay the university bursar directly, he completely avoids federal taxation on the interest. The structural rigidity of the tax code forces him to align specific asset liquidations with exact qualified life events.
| Asset Owner Location | Eligible for Tax Exclusion? | Income Tax Liability on Non-Qualified Cash Out |
|---|---|---|
| Registered to Parent with Child as Beneficiary | Yes, subject to parent income limits | Parent pays at marginal bracket |
| Registered directly to Minor Child | No, permanently disqualified | Child pays, Kiddie Tax rules apply |
| Registered to Grandparent | No, unless grandparent claims child as dependent | Grandparent pays at marginal bracket |
Municipal Bonds and the High-Net-Worth Minor
When a minor child generates unearned income from a massive custodial brokerage account, they inevitably collide with the federal Kiddie Tax. If a teenager holds a massive corporate bond portfolio generating ten thousand dollars a year in ordinary interest dividends, the family faces a severe tax penalty. Most of that ten thousand dollars will be taxed exactly as if the high-earning parents earned it themselves, severely dragging down the real return of the portfolio. To combat this specific tax trap, high-net-worth families frequently pivot away from United States Treasury debt and corporate bonds, reallocating the child's capital into municipal bonds.
Municipal bonds represent debt issued by state and local governments to fund infrastructure projects like highways, schools, and hospitals. The federal government subsidizes this local borrowing by making the interest payments completely exempt from federal income taxes. If a child's Uniform Transfers to Minors Act account holds a municipal bond fund, the monthly dividends bypass the federal tax system entirely. Because the income is federally tax-exempt, it does not trigger the Kiddie Tax thresholds. Evaluating municipal bonds requires calculating the specific tax-equivalent yield to determine if the strategy actually works.
This strategy only applies to wealthy families whose children hold account balances large enough to generate thousands of dollars in annual yield. For the average family dropping fifty dollars a month into a brokerage account, the Kiddie Tax remains mathematically irrelevant, and they should simply focus on maximizing total return through equities or capturing the inflation protection of Treasury debt rather than hiding in tax-exempt municipals.
Calculating Tax-Equivalent Yields Against Federal Treasuries
To definitively prove whether a municipal bond or a Treasury bond serves the child better, you must calculate the tax-equivalent yield. The formula divides the tax-free municipal yield by one minus the child's marginal tax rate. If a high-grade municipal bond yields three and a half percent, and the child's effective federal tax rate on that specific income sits at ten percent, the tax-equivalent yield equals roughly three point eight eight percent. You then compare that three point eight eight percent directly against current Treasury yields.
If a standard US Treasury bond currently yields four and a half percent, the Treasury mathematically destroys the municipal bond for that specific child. The parent should buy the higher-yielding Treasury, let the child pay the tiny ten percent tax bill, and keep the larger net profit. Only when a custodial account grows so massive that it pushes the child deeply into the parent's top marginal tax bracket under the Kiddie Tax rules do municipal bonds begin to make mathematical sense. For almost every American family, Treasuries beat municipals in a minor's portfolio.
Integrating Treasury Assets with 529 Plans
The standard 529 college savings plan relies heavily on target enrollment portfolios. These funds automatically shift the asset allocation away from aggressive stock market indexes and toward conservative fixed income as the child approaches college age. However, the fixed income portion of a 529 plan usually consists of aggregate bond market mutual funds. These funds still carry duration risk and can lose value in a rising rate environment. Parents seeking absolute certainty often build a hybrid strategy. They use the 529 plan strictly for massive equity growth during the child's early years. As the child enters high school, instead of letting the 529 plan transition into potentially volatile bond funds, the parents direct new cash flow away from the 529 and straight into individual Treasury notes maturing exactly when the tuition bills arrive.
This dual approach provides the geometric growth of the 529 plan during the early accumulation phase while securing an absolute mathematical floor during the distribution phase. You hold the equities where they enjoy tax-free growth, and you hold the Treasury bonds where they provide absolute date-specific liquidity. You do not mix the purposes. The 529 remains an engine. The Treasury ladder remains a bridge.
The Impact of Student-Owned Bonds on the FAFSA
Families must understand how these assets interact with financial aid calculations. A parent-owned 529 plan faces a maximum assessment rate of 5.64 percent in the Free Application for Federal Student Aid algorithm. A savings bond or Treasury note registered directly in the child's name under a custodial structure faces a brutal twenty percent assessment rate. The formula expects the student to surrender a fifth of their personal assets to the university every single year. Families anticipating need-based financial aid must carefully balance the guaranteed yield of a Treasury bond against the severe penalty of holding that bond in the student's name.
To operate around this trap, parents must deliberately choose where to store the government debt. If the family anticipates qualifying for significant need-based aid based on their ordinary household income, they must avoid putting massive bond portfolios directly in the child's name. The parent should buy the bonds in the parent's primary account. This achieves two goals simultaneously. It drops the financial aid assessment rate from twenty percent down to five percent. It also perfectly preserves the parent's ability to claim the Education Tax Exclusion when they cash the bonds, as the parent meets the age and ownership requirements.
| Asset Owner Location | FAFSA Assessment Rate | Impact on Need-Based Aid |
|---|---|---|
| Parent Primary Account | Maximum 5.64% | Minimal reduction in grants |
| Child Custodial Account | Flat 20.00% | Severe reduction in grants |
| Parent-Owned 529 Plan | Maximum 5.64% | Minimal reduction in grants |
Reflections on Generational Debt and Capital
I spend a considerable amount of time looking at yield curves and evaluating inflation data to determine exactly how capital behaves over long horizons. Watching a family obsess over the daily fluctuations of a technology stock while simultaneously leaving twenty thousand dollars in a checking account earning zero interest continually surprises me. We train ourselves to fear the stock market, yet we happily allow inflation to silently steal our purchasing power every single year. Directing funds into Series I savings bonds or a targeted Treasury ladder requires acknowledging that cash is not a risk-free asset. Uninvested cash guarantees a loss of value. When I construct these fixed-income structures, I view the government debt not as an investment, but as a heavily fortified holding cell for money that already has a designated purpose. You use the Treasury to lock the value in place.
The administrative friction of operating government portals feels infuriating, but the discipline required to maintain these accounts builds a necessary boundary between long-term wealth and short-term spending. By locking cash up in a one-year savings bond or a three-year Treasury note, you effectively protect the capital from your own behavioral impulses. You cannot panic-sell a locked asset during a recession. You cannot quietly drain the account to cover an expensive holiday vacation. The structure forces you to wait until the maturity date arrives. I value this forced patience as highly as I value the state-tax-free yield. You accept the archaic interface and the stringent regulations specifically to secure a financial floor that the broader equity markets simply cannot provide.
